Jamika Gregorio: If you did not meet your academic requirements like passing all, or most classes each semester then the short answer is yes however in some cases it is possible to fix. Contact your financial aid office, inform them of your situation at the time, if one can provide documented proof then it could possibly be remedied
Hubert Jestes: Financial aid has two parts to the SAP requirements:- Maintain a 2.0 average.- Maintain a 67% completion rate.Your GPA obviously doesn't meet that, and your financial aid will likely be suspended.
